What are the downsides of purchasing a repossessed property?

Obtaining a discount on a house is awesome, but there are associated hazards involved in this. Banks sell such houses without statutory warranty.

That means that when there is a problem with the house or a hidden vice, you are unable to take legal action against them or receive any financial redress. It’s sold “as is”.

For that reason, obtaining a mortgage loan in order to finance your property can be substantially more difficult as lenders are usually more careful.

Also, with regards to the previous owners who defaulted on their monthly home loan payments, sometimes these people also neglected the home, damaged it or even made use of the premises to grow cannabis which may result in mold.

Checking out the building prior to putting in an offer is obviously recommended, however sometimes it’s difficult to pay a visit to them and may well require a down payment or even a blind offer.

These are things to take into account before taking things further, despite the fact that it’s not always the case.

Distressed House Sales & Motivated Sellers

Distress property sales or determined vendors may be much more rewarding when compared to a repossession. These kinds of houses might be a pre-repossession or basically a vendor who wants to sell up quickly for many different reasons.

Pre-repossessions / 60-day property foreclosure instruction

With a pre-repossession, the owner must get rid of it really quickly to be able to protect his or her property equity before the lender forecloses on the estate. As a whole, the bank has provided them with a sixty-day instruction.

Bogged down with two home loans

A further cause for an owner to be motivated to sell for a lower amount may be for the reason that they’ve recently bought another property before attempting to sell the current one and don’t want to be trapped by two home loans.

Purchasing another house as a condition of selling their existing property

It could additionally be the case that the owner has made a bid on another purchase which has an offer conditional to sell his present one. This might be their dream house or they may be just obliged to stick with this deal and thereby prepared to accept your offer.

Succession / Heritage house sales or property liquidation

Inheritance home sales could be good finds as well as the new owner who may have only just inherited his or her house may be sometimes wanting to sell the property below the the market value due to a few different reasons.

Frequently, they just want the equity as soon as possible. In addition, selling off the property makes it easier to split up the asset in the event that there are multiple benefactors to the estate.

Fixer-Upper Properties

Houses which require refurbishment may be yet another superb opportunity. These houses which need some love tend to be generally priced lower than market price.

You can produce a nice margin after all costs if you’ve got a supplementary allowance for renovating the place and can do all of the renovations by yourself.

If your plan is to live in the property, then you also can personalize it to your individual preferences and requirements.

When it’s for a flip, in order to maximize resale valuation and market appeal you can do strategic renovations.

Like in every other real estate purchase, having the home checked out is a must in ensuring that there’s no significant repair required that can change your property deal into a profitless fiasco.

Owners who have to sell as a result of divorce proceedings

Divorce or separation has never been pretty and the home circumstances could be very uncomfortable. Whilst the couple may possibly come up with a short-term fix where one person moves out to someplace else, the truth that one person stays in the house and the other one has to move may well create even more arguments and unfairness.

In most instances, the very best course of action is usually to sell the property as soon as possible so they can move ahead with their own everyday lives. They will be able to each buy their own property after they make use of the collateral.
